Nexus is free amateur radio software. It runs FT8, FT4, RTTY, PSK, SSTV, WSPR and the weak signal modes, plus CW, phone, satellites and APRS, with the logbook, rig control and band map in one window instead of five programs talking to each other over UDP. Windows, macOS, Linux and Raspberry Pi, in five languages.
It is GPL-3.0. Every feature is in every copy. No paid tier, no licence key, no pro version, and there never will be. Sponsorship unlocks nothing, because there is nothing to unlock.
